I don't really think so. I've owned a few Android and IOS tablets over the years, and immediately stopped using any, once I purchased a ~15 inch laptop. Media consumption is close to the only thing you can really do well on a tablet, and now, I truly believe a laptop can do it better.
Beyond that, a laptop can actually have work done on it, is much easier to use in places besides the toilet, and is not only upgradable, but infinitely serviceable, as you, the owner, controls what software it runs, and can run.
The only place I can see the tablet surviving in, is with people who don't actually use their devices, and for pro-sumers, purchasing high power Windows or Linux based tablets. I don't think that last one really makes up much of the population though, as if you're going to shell out for laptop components in a tablet form factor, you might as well just get a laptop.
